Output 6baf01c70f2852ce414b5765f33ee5ec8acf969a3c89ffb688d64f34a7493cc9:19

value
10825008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f8da2b6a8f2598df6a1807535951b54693f700 OP_EQUAL
address
3LCEXrD1VJYb8YnTV6mfnQdj4tou9ZYvcE
transaction
6baf01c70f2852ce414b5765f33ee5ec8acf969a3c89ffb688d64f34a7493cc9
spent
true